Исправление: DistMgr медленной обработки файлов .pul из запросу DP в System Center Configuration Manager версии 1511

ВНИМАНИЕ! Данная статья переведена с использованием программного обеспечения Майкрософт для машинного перевода и, возможно, отредактирована посредством технологии Community Translation Framework (CTF). Корпорация Майкрософт предлагает вам статьи, обработанные средствами машинного перевода, отредактированные членами сообщества Майкрософт и переведенные профессиональными переводчиками, чтобы вы могли ознакомиться со всеми статьями нашей базы знаний на нескольких языках. Статьи, переведенные с использованием средств машинного перевода и отредактированные сообществом, могут содержать смысловое, синтаксические и (или) грамматические ошибки. Корпорация Майкрософт не несет ответственности за любые неточности, ошибки или ущерб, вызванные неправильным переводом контента или его использованием нашими клиентами. Подробнее об CTF можно узнать по адресу http://support.microsoft.com/gp/machine-translation-corrections/ru.

Эта статья на английском языке: 3101706
Проблема
Рассмотрим следующий сценарий:
  • Вы используете Microsoft System Center Configuration Manager версии 1511.
  • Создание большого количества пакетов (например, нескольких сотен) и распространять их с большим количеством точек распространения запросу (например, тысячи их).

Когда DistMgr обрабатывает .pul файлов из точки распространения запросу (DPs) в этом случае, DistMgr выполняется следующий запрос, который принимает 3 – 4 секунд при наличии большого количества строк в таблице PkgStatus:

select s.ID, s.PkgServer, s.SiteCode, p.StoredPkgVersion, s.Status, r.PkgVersion, r.ActionState, r.ActionData, p.PkgFlags, p.ShareType from PullDPResponse r join PkgStatus s on r.PkgStatusID = s.PKID AND r.PkgStatusID = PUL_ID join SMSPackages p on s.ID = p.PkgID 

Причина
Эта проблема возникает, так как представление PkgStatus использует инструкцию ISNULL и в этом случае SQL для выполнения сканирования индекса вместо Index Seek.
Решение
После установки исправления DistMgr обрабатывает файлы .pul из запросу DP, DistMgr выполняется следующий запрос, который принимает около 28 мс для запуска:

select s.ID, s.PkgServer, s.SiteCode, p.StoredPkgVersion, s.Status, r.PkgVersion, r.ActionState, r.ActionData, p.PkgFlags, p.ShareType from PkgStatus2 s join PullDPResponse r on r.PkgStatusID = s.PKID AND s.PKID = 72057594038363660 join SMSPackages p on s.ID = p.PkgID 

Сведения об исправлении

Доступно исправление от службы поддержки Майкрософт. Однако данное исправление предназначено для устранения только проблемы, описанной в этой статье. Применяйте это исправление только в тех случаях, когда наблюдается проблема, описанная в данной статье. Это исправление может проходить дополнительное тестирование. Таким образом если вы не подвержены серьезно этой проблеме, рекомендуется дождаться следующего пакета обновления, содержащего это исправление.

Если исправление доступно для загрузки, имеется раздел "Исправление доступно для загрузки" в верхней части этой статьи базы знаний. Если этот раздел не отображается, обратитесь в службу поддержки для получения исправления.

Примечание Если наблюдаются другие проблемы или необходимо устранить неполадки, вам может понадобиться создать отдельный запрос на обслуживание. Обычные затраты на поддержку будет применяться к дополнительные вопросы и проблемы, которые не соответствуют требованиям конкретного исправления. Для получения полного списка телефонов поддержки и обслуживания клиентов корпорации Майкрософт, или для создания отдельного запроса на обслуживание, посетите следующий веб-сайт Майкрософт: Примечание В форме "Исправление доступно для загрузки" отображаются языки, для которых доступно исправление. Если нужный язык не отображается, это потому, что исправление для данного языка отсутствует.

Предварительные условия

Для установки этого исправления необходимо иметь System Center Configuration Manager версии установлены 1511.

Сведения о перезагрузке компьютера

Не требуется перезагружать компьютер после установки данного исправления.

Сведения о замене исправлений

Это исправление не заменяет все ранее выпущенные исправления.

Сведения о файлах

Английская версия данного исправления содержит атрибуты файла (или более поздние атрибуты файлов), приведенные в следующей таблице. Дата и время для этих файлов указаны в формате общего скоординированного времени (UTC). При просмотре сведений о файле, он преобразуется в локальное время. Чтобы узнать разницу между временем по Гринвичу и местным временем, откройте вкладку Часовой пояс элемента Дата и время в панели управления.

Имя файлаВерсия файлаРазмер файлаДатаВремяПлатформа
Update.SQLНеприменимо2,04624 ноября 2015 г.01:00Неприменимо
Статус
Корпорация Майкрософт подтверждает, что это проблема продуктов Майкрософт, перечисленных в разделе "Относится к".
Ссылки
Дополнительные сведения о Терминология , которые корпорация Майкрософт использует для описания обновлений программного обеспечения.

Внимание! Эта статья переведена автоматически

Свойства

Номер статьи: 3101706 — последний просмотр: 01/01/2016 03:32:00 — редакция: 1.0

System Center Configuration Manager version 1511

  • kbqfe kbautohotfix kbhotfixserver kbfix kbsurveynew kbexpertiseinter kbmt KB3101706 KbMtru
Отзывы и предложения